MOMco Deliver Donations to Houston’s New Servant Center

With a huge thank you to the MOMCo – Friendswood ladies for their generous in-gathering of items donated to Orphan Grain Train Houston – 3 SUVs packed to the dash and doors. Board member Holly Harris shared a presentation about the OGT ministry along with information about Houston’s new OGT Servant Center. Holly and Board member Erika Adams answered questions and shared details about volunteer opportunities.
